Key Responsibilities

The role will include:

  • Daily reconciliation of the firm's bank accounts.
  • Processing and allocating incoming client monies via Internet Banking.
  • Making payments from the firm's accounts by electronic payment or cheque, in accordance with internal procedures and SRA requirements.
  • Checking and processing bills.
  • Checking client balances and liaising with fee earners to ensure outstanding balances are cleared following completion.
  • Ensuring client balances are returned promptly where appropriate.
  • Processing transfers of costs and disbursements.
  • Taking card payments from clients over the telephone.
  • Supporting fee earners and secretaries with financial queries and providing guidance on finance-related matters.
  • Responding to queries via email, telephone and online meetings.
  • Identifying and reporting any breaches promptly and supporting their resolution.
  • Logging incoming cheques and ensuring postings are requested where required.
  • Providing general support to the Accounts team as required.
